Item note for D – series A6202
Descriptive note
This item consists of 27 separate pieces numbered D1 – D27.
D1- D4 are a deciphered list of insertions handwritten in ink on two ruled pages.
D5 – D27 constitute Moscow Letter number 3 of 1952 consisting of 23 contact prints mounted on card.
Folios D3-D4 were created as subitems and removed from their parent file for display purposes from 6 Aug 2004 to 4 April 2005. These folios have now been returned to file and the subitem registration cancelled. Preservation 20 May 2005.
